La Parisienne: The Official Battle Cry
While various songs have echoed around the stadium over the decades, "La Parisienne" remains the definitive PSG anthem. Officially adopted in 1972, the song was originally written for the city of Paris itself. However, the players and fans quickly adopted it as their own, transforming it into a declaration of identity. The lyrics, focusing on the spirit of the city, perfectly mirror the club’s aspiration to represent Paris on the grandest stage possible, turning every home match into a civic celebration.
